This is how I would do it.

I would post all 11 online.

Then I would go to the File > Publish Online Dashboard where all the files will be listed.

I would find the link for the second section and put it in the first section then update the first section with the link for the second section.

Then I would find the link for the third section and put it in the second section. Then update the second section with this new information for the link to the third section.

I would probably put the links at the end of each section.

But you could put all the links in each of the sections. It depends on what type of content you have.

Putting the links in requires using the Hyperlinks panel. If you need a tutorial for that, let us know.

First thing I would do is divide the project in half and try to upload the first half. I figure it you're crashing at about the 80% mark, then the first 50% must have gotten through.

I would also look at what is around the 80% mark of your project. Is there some huge set of pictures? Or a video? Or whatever?

I only mentioned dividing the job into 11 sections because you seem to have those divisions already.

Publishing to PDF and then PubOnline won't work at all. You can make a PDF and then host it on your own server, but that's not Publish Online.

However, do investigate the ability of Publish Online to also provide a PDF for people who visit the site to download. You don't upload that PDF. Adobe makes it from the Publish Online version.
